Lego trail rail crossing automated by Arduino: How It Works. This video explains the functionality of the automated Lego train rail crossing.

This video shows a double rail crossing which is automated by Arduino. Two sensors indicate whether a train that has priority is apporaching the crossing. In this case, the tracks of the non-priorrity lego train tracks are disabled and the Lego train signals are put to red. As long as the train enables the sensor, the non-priority lego train tracks remain disabled. Once the priority lego train has passed the sensor, an adjustable timer is started, to disable the tracks a bit longer to make sure the priority Lego train has cleared the Lego rail crossing. After that the signals are put to green and the non-priority tracks are started using PWM technology.
